The stepper drivers on the cohesion3d do cause noisier operation. That is very common. Raster Speeds over 300 or so with smoothie become iffy so you can dial back the speed or use grbl firmware. It processes scans way faster. If you are referring to adjusting the pots on the stepper sticks, put them back as instructed in the install directions and i will link instructions on how to measeure and set vref correctly to match the motors

Tech Bravo (Tech BravoTN) October 02, 2018 21:04

yeah smoothie is fine for many people and it’s the best “one size fits all” solution. the glcd display isn’t compatible with grbl so that may play into it some. Smoothie has known limits for GCode processing throughout (about 800 to 1000 GCode lines per second). grbl does not suffer from this limitation. there are, as with anything, pros and cons. once dialed in the c3d is super stable. if you mostly do raster scans give this a look: cohesion3d.freshdesk.com - GRBL-LPC for Cohesion3D Mini : Cohesion3D
